Storytime Theme: Ocean Animals
Books
- Crab Cake by Andrea Tsurumi
- Hooray for Fish! by Lucy Cousins
- I Am the Shark by Joan Holub, illustrated by Laurie Keller
- Just Be Jelly by Maddie Frost
- Not Quite Narwhal by Jessie Sima
- Over In the Ocean In a Coral Reef by Marianne Berkes, illustrated by Jeanette Canyon
- Save Your Friends by Hyewon Kyung
- The Sea Hides a Seahorse by Sara T. Behrman, illustrated by Melanie Mikecz
- Who’s Afraid of the Light? by Anna McGregor
